A woman has been banned from her local McDonald’s after going on a vodka-fuelled rampage and causing hundreds of pounds worth of damage. The 20-year-old has been handed a two-year Criminal Behaviour Order (CBO) which bans her from the premises after terrorising staff and customers.
Wilkins, of Four Oaks Close, Redditch, was found guilty at Worcester Magistrates Court on Tuesday of entering McDonald’s on Clews Drive on July 19 when she had been drinking vodka. She went into the toilets and stuffed toilet paper in the sinks and turned the taps on and left causing the toilets to flood.
West Mercia Police says she then smothered the walls in tomato ketchup and smashed a large window near the front of the store, causing £738 in damages.
Wilkins was found guilty of the offence at Worcester Magistrates’ Court and handed a CBO which lasts until 2027, which prohibits her from causing a public nuisance or entering the branch on Clews Drive.
Other conditions on her CBO prohibits her from “refusing to leave a premises or area when asked by someone who has authority to do so”, and “consuming alcohol or being in possession of an open vessel of alcohol in a public place”.
